Foxtable(狐表)用户栏目专家坐堂 → [求助]郁闷,在动态加载的查询表中设置当前行的背景色怎么也不成功,此问题解决,又有一个问题


  共有3467人关注过本帖树形打印复制链接

主题:[求助]郁闷,在动态加载的查询表中设置当前行的背景色怎么也不成功,此问题解决,又有一个问题

帅哥哟,离线,有人找我吗?
huangfanzi
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:五尾狐 帖子:1105 积分:8967 威望:0 精华:0 注册:2014/10/25 11:24:00
[求助]郁闷,在动态加载的查询表中设置当前行的背景色怎么也不成功,此问题解决,又有一个问题  发帖心情 Post By:2015/3/1 3:20:00 [只看该作者]

DataTables("库存查询主窗口_Table_查询表").SysStyles("Focus").BackColor = Color.red 这个设置单元格能成功
DataTables("库存查询主窗口_Table_查询表").SysStyles("CurrentRow").BackColor = Color.red 这个设置当前行背景色的怎么也不行
窗口中表的类型是SQLQuery
在窗口的afterload中加了 Tables("库存查询主窗口_Table_查询表").UseVisualStyle = False 代码
为什么啊???
[此贴子已经被作者于2015/3/1 12:19:50编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2015/3/1 9:26:00 [只看该作者]

DataTables("表A").SysStyles("CurrentRow").BackColor = Color.red
Tables("表A").ListMode = True

 回到顶部
帅哥哟,离线,有人找我吗?
huangfanzi
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:五尾狐 帖子:1105 积分:8967 威望:0 精华:0 注册:2014/10/25 11:24:00
  发帖心情 Post By:2015/3/1 12:18:00 [只看该作者]

原来是ListMode,昨晚搞到3点也没搞明白,查论坛数据也没找到。

另外请教下,我想在窗口中的表打开时自动把所有卷号为001的记录行的背景色变为红色
以上代码应该如何写,请老师举个例子
[此贴子已经被作者于2015/3/1 14:05:15编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2015/3/1 14:22:00 [只看该作者]


 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2015/3/1 14:23:00 [只看该作者]

 如果是窗口表,要这样处理

 

http://www.foxtable.com/help/topics/2628.htm

 


 回到顶部
帅哥哟,离线,有人找我吗?
huangfanzi
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:五尾狐 帖子:1105 积分:8967 威望:0 精华:0 注册:2014/10/25 11:24:00
  发帖心情 Post By:2015/3/1 15:37:00 [只看该作者]

根据教程代码:
If e.Col.Name = "数量" Then
    If e.Row("数量") >= 500 Then
        e.Style = "a"
    End 
If

End
 If

此代码是把满足条件的单元格设置成样式a,我希望把满足条件的单元格的所在行设置成样式a,代码应该如何改?

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2015/3/1 15:38:00 [只看该作者]

    If e.Row("数量") >= 500 Then
        e.Style = "a"
    End 
If


 回到顶部